The British Red Cross is providing basic life saving skills training to rural and isolated communities in Devon, Cornwall, Dorset and Somerset. It is to provide "short term crisis care" until the ambulance service arrives. The project is funded by Tescos.
It is hoped that this training will draw in members of the community who can then go on to become peer trainers/educators thus sustaining and building on the project.
This is a free 2 hour course for 12 people in a suitable village hall or large room run by one of our qualified First Aid trainers.
